The Kenworth T680 Air Park Brake Valves, part number 11420817, is a crucial component in the braking system of the 2020 Kenworth T680 truck equipped with the G90-6036 engine and KWHD20 hybrid drive system. This product is manufactured by Kenworth, a renowned name in the heavy-duty truck industry, ensuring high-quality and reliability.
The Air Park Brake Valves are designed to regulate the air pressure in the braking system of the truck. These valves are essential for the proper functioning of the air brakes, ensuring safe and efficient braking performance. The valves are constructed using durable materials to withstand the rigors of heavy-duty use, ensuring longevity and reliability.
The valves are easy to install, requiring no special tools or extensive mechanical knowledge. They are designed to fit seamlessly into the existing braking system of the Kenworth T680, making them a straightforward replacement for worn-out or faulty valves.
In terms of dimensions, the Air Park Brake Valves have a length of 12.5 inches, a width of 5 inches, and a height of 5.5 inches. They weigh approximately 12 pounds, making them easy to handle during installation or replacement.
